Summary:

Zip code 83672 is home to a single middle school, Weiser Middle School, which serves grades 6 through 8 as part of the Weiser District. With 334 students enrolled, the school provides the only public middle school option in the area. The student-teacher ratio is a reasonable 15:1, and about 49.4% of students q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, reflecting a substantial low-income population. Per-student spending is $6,142, which is relatively modest and may impact the availability of intervention programs and support staff.

Weiser Middle School shows a mix of strengths and challenges. The school’s 8th grade English Language Arts proficiency is a clear highlight, with 56.6% of students proficient—above the state average of 54.5%. Overall, ELA proficiency improves steadily by grade level, rising from 39.1% in 6th grade to 48.5% in 7th grade and 56.6% in 8th grade. By contrast, math proficiency is a concern, especially in 6th grade, where only 27.3% of students are proficient compared to the state average of 42.5%. Overall math proficiency stands at 35.3% versus the state’s 43.1%. Science performance is relatively solid, with 41.4% proficiency in 8th grade, just 1.5 points below the state average. Chronic absenteeism is elevated at 16.9%, higher than both the district rate of 16.2% and the state rate of 13.8%.

Encouragingly, Weiser Middle School is trending upward. Between 2024–2025 and 2025–2026, math proficiency improved from 29.3% to 35.3%, and ELA proficiency rose from 45.0% to 48.8%. The school’s state ranking also improved significantly from the 17th to the 30th percentile, with its star rating moving from one star to two stars. The most pressing areas for improvement are 6th grade math and chronic absenteeism, both of which likely contribute to the school’s below-average overall performance. However, the school’s strong year-over-year gains, particularly in literacy, and its competitive 8th grade ELA results suggest that targeted efforts in early middle school math and attendance could help close the gap with state averages in the years ahead.
